How do I check if current time and a custom time are within device time slot (wall clock time) of 30 mins

616 Views Asked by At

I have a unique issue where I have to determine 2 things.

1) if my current time and a custom time are within the same 30 min time slot ( say its 2:10pm and the custom time is 2:22pm , I want to see they are within the same time slot from 2 to 2:30 ) but shouldn't be in the same time slot if current time is 1:55pm and custom time is 2:15pm (30 min difference but not within the same device/clock time slot as one is 1:30 to 2pm and another is 2 to 2:30pm)

2) Now, within the same time slot of 30 mins, if current time is before the custom time, I want to return a true, else return a false. any way to calculate this? I am looking to add a custom function in my common utils class where I can feed it custom time and current time and see the result, so would be useful to have something generic. Any ideas?

I have looked at : Check if a given time lies between two times regardless of date and other articles but nothing describes the 30 min device/clock time slot period.

Any idea if https://commons.apache.org/proper/commons-lang/apidocs/org/apache/commons/lang3/time/DateUtils.html will somehow help me manipulate this exact logic or any custom function/library in android helps with this. will be really helpful!

nagendra patod On BEST ANSWER
package Demo;

import java.time.LocalDateTime;
import java.time.temporal.ChronoUnit;
import java.util.Arrays;
public class Test1 {
    public static void main(String arg[]) {
        LocalDateTime ct = LocalDateTime.now();
        LocalDateTime custemTime = ct.plusMinutes(5);
        System.out.println(ct);
        System.out.println(custemTime)  ;
        System.out.println(isInSameSlots(ct,custemTime));

    }   
    static boolean   isInSameSlots(LocalDateTime ldt1, LocalDateTime ltd2) {
        Long timeDiff = ChronoUnit.MINUTES.between(ldt1, ltd2);
        if(timeDiff > 30 || timeDiff < 0) 
           return false;
        return (ldt1.getMinute() <= 30 && ltd2.getMinute() <= 30) || (ldt1.getMinute() > 30 && ltd2.getMinute() > 30 ) ? true : false; 

    }

}

case 1

2019-06-10T18:40:09.122

2019-06-10T18:45:09.122

true

Case 2 ) 2019-06-10T18:46:56.350 2019-06-10T19:06:56.350 false
